Abstract
The purpose of this study was to investigate whether common variants in inflammatory and immune response genes influence inflammatory bowel disease (IBD) risk among Moroccan patients. Using a candidate gene approach, 10 single-nucleotide polymorphisms map** on six genes (MIF_rs755622, TNFA_rs1800629, IL6_rs2069840, IL6R_rs2228145, IL6ST_rs2228044, IL17A (rs2275913, rs4711998, rs7747909, rs8193036, rs3819024)) were assessed in 510 subjects grouped in 199 IBD and 311 healthy controls. Genoty** was performed with the TaqMan allelic discrimination technology. The results were analyzed using PLINK software. The frequency of allele A for TNFA rs1800629 was significantly higher in ulcerative colitis (UC) patients compared with controls (30.16 vs 16.72%; P=0.0005; odds ratio (OR)=2.15; 95% confidence interval (CI)=1.39–3.32). Statistically significant association to UC was also found under dominant AA+AG vs GG (OR=1.85, 95% CI=1.07–3.21; P=0.02) and recessive models (OR=8.38; 95% CI=2.86–24.53; P=0.0001). In the same way, an association of TNFA rs1800629 variant was observed with IBD under recessive model AA vs AG+GG (OR=4.10; 95% CI=1.56–10.76; P=0.004). No evidence of significant associations was found for the remaining investigated polymorphisms. Our data suggest that TNFA gene promoter polymorphism participates in determining IBD susceptibility in Moroccan patients.
